Age-friendly device selection

Separate home, community, and care-organization needs first

Selection should focus on whether older users can hear, read, and complete tasks with few steps, and how caregivers manage devices and content. Companion and reminder functions do not replace diagnosis, treatment, or emergency services.

How do home and care-organization AI companion devices differ?

Home use emphasizes natural voice, simple reminders, family content, and consent. Organizations also need device groups, accounts and permissions, consistent content, network and charging operations, staff workflows, and incident handling. Map the actual service flow before comparing feature counts.

What determines the cost of an AI companion device for older adults?

Device form, display and controls, dialect and voice scope, connectivity, reminders and content, device management, privacy permissions, quantities, deployment training, and ongoing service all affect the estimate. Medical data, health recommendations, or emergency integration require separate compliance and responsibility review.

How should dialect support, large text, and low-step interaction be tested?

Invite target-age and dialect users to complete tasks under realistic noise, distance, lighting, and network conditions. Record wake-up, recognition, playback, text size, controls, navigation, and recovery from failure. Use task completion and recovery behavior as acceptance evidence, not only an office demo.
